Childcare costs in Summit
ChildCare Aware reports the Mississippi average full-time cost at $650/month for infant care and $540/month for preschool. City-level prices in Summit vary by ZIP code and program model — Head Start sites are free for eligible families, family daycare homes typically run 10-30% below center rates, and accredited centers run above the average.
The Child & Dependent Care Tax Credit and a Dependent Care FSA ($5,000 max) reduce effective cost regardless of program. Mississippi families may also qualify for Mississippi Child Care Payment Program (CCPP) (intake: (800) 877-7882).
